As businesses take greater control of their infrastructure, independent internet routing is no longer something only traditional Internet Service Providers need. SaaS companies, hosting platforms, cloud operators, enterprises with multiple data centres, and organisations using leased IPv4 space may all reach a point where relying entirely on an upstream provider's routing decisions becomes limiting.

An Autonomous System Number (ASN) allows a network to participate in Border Gateway Protocol (BGP) routing and establish its own identity on the global internet. Yet many businesses that need an ASN do not want to become an ISP or take on every administrative responsibility associated with direct registry relationships.

This is where ASN sponsorship can be useful. A sponsoring organisation can handle applicable registry administration while the business operates the ASN for legitimate routing purposes. The exact arrangement depends on the relevant Regional Internet Registry (RIR), so sponsorship should always follow the policies of the registry involved rather than being treated as a universal shortcut.

What Is an ASN?

An Autonomous System Number is a unique identifier assigned to a network that exchanges routing information with other autonomous networks.

On the public internet, ASNs are used with Border Gateway Protocol (BGP) to identify which network originates a route and how that route is exchanged with other providers.

Having an ASN enables an organisation to:

  • Connect to multiple upstream providers
  • Establish independent BGP routing policies
  • Improve redundancy and failover
  • Control inbound and outbound traffic paths
  • Reduce dependence on a single provider
  • Build direct peering relationships where appropriate

Although an ASN provides routing independence, it does not make a business an Internet Service Provider. It simply gives the organisation greater control over how its network communicates with the rest of the internet.

Why Non-ISPs Cannot Always Obtain an ASN Directly

ASNs are administered by the five Regional Internet Registries:

  • ARIN
  • RIPE NCC
  • APNIC
  • LACNIC
  • AFRINIC

These organisations manage internet number resources according to established policies. While businesses can obtain an ASN directly in many situations, doing so often requires meeting specific technical and administrative requirements.

Depending on the registry, organisations may need to demonstrate:

  • A legitimate routing requirement
  • Technical capability to operate BGP
  • Compliance with registry policies
  • Ongoing administrative responsibilities
  • Accurate registration information

For many businesses, especially those whose primary focus is not network operations, managing these obligations may create unnecessary complexity.

What ASN Sponsorship Means

ASN sponsorship is an arrangement in which an eligible registry member or sponsoring organisation manages the administrative relationship with the relevant registry while the business uses the ASN for its routing requirements.

Although the exact process differs between Regional Internet Registries, sponsorship generally involves:

  • Registry administration handled by the sponsor
  • Accurate registration records
  • Policy-compliant ASN management
  • Legitimate BGP operation
  • Ongoing administrative support where applicable

This allows organisations to gain the benefits of independent routing without taking on every aspect of registry membership themselves.

It is important to distinguish legitimate ASN sponsorship from informal arrangements where organisations attempt to use another company's ASN without proper documentation or registry alignment.

How ASN Sponsorship Works

Although procedures vary depending on the registry and provider, the process generally follows several stages.

Define the Routing Requirement

The organisation first determines why independent routing is necessary.

Typical reasons include:

  • Multihoming
  • Provider redundancy
  • Independent traffic engineering
  • Hybrid cloud networking
  • Announcing public IPv4 prefixes

A clearly documented routing requirement forms the foundation of the sponsorship process.

Establish the Sponsorship Arrangement

The sponsoring organisation gathers the necessary administrative information and prepares the required registry documentation.

This may include:

  • Organisation details
  • Technical contacts
  • Network information
  • Routing justification
  • Administrative records

The sponsor ensures the administrative side of the process complies with applicable registry policies.

Prepare the Network

Obtaining an ASN does not automatically make a network routable.

The organisation must still deploy:

  • BGP-capable routers
  • Appropriate upstream connectivity
  • Routing policies
  • Prefix filtering
  • Monitoring systems

Operational readiness remains the responsibility of the network operator.

Configure Routing

Once administrative requirements have been completed, BGP sessions can be established with upstream providers and authorised prefixes can be announced according to the organisation's routing policies.

Testing should confirm:

  • Route propagation
  • Reachability
  • Failover behaviour
  • Routing stability
  • External visibility

Proper testing helps ensure a successful production deployment.

ASN Sponsorship and IPv4 Leasing

ASN sponsorship becomes particularly important when organisations lease public IPv4 address space.

Leased IPv4 prefixes often need to be announced through a properly managed ASN in order to operate on the public internet.

A compliant routing arrangement typically requires:

  • Valid authority to use the IPv4 block
  • An appropriate ASN
  • Accurate registry records
  • Correct routing configuration
  • Acceptance by upstream providers

Without proper coordination, organisations may experience routing problems or fail to meet registry expectations.

Businesses planning to lease IPv4 resources should consider routing requirements before deployment rather than after the address space has already been acquired.

RPKI and Routing Security

Modern internet routing increasingly relies on additional security mechanisms beyond traditional BGP configuration.

One of the most important is the Resource Public Key Infrastructure (RPKI).

RPKI allows organisations to publish Route Origin Authorizations (ROAs) that specify which ASN is authorised to originate a particular IPv4 prefix.

When implemented correctly, RPKI helps:

  • Reduce accidental route leaks
  • Prevent unauthorised route announcements
  • Improve routing validation
  • Increase confidence in internet routing

Although not every network validates RPKI today, adoption continues to grow across the internet.

Organisations operating public infrastructure should include routing security as part of their overall network strategy.

Risks of Improper ASN Usage

Some organisations attempt to simplify deployment by borrowing ASNs, using undocumented routing arrangements, or operating without proper administrative records.

These practices introduce significant risks, including:

  • Routing disputes
  • Prefix filtering
  • Registry compliance issues
  • Operational instability
  • Connectivity loss
  • Difficulties during provider changes

A properly managed sponsorship arrangement provides clear operational responsibility and reduces the likelihood of these problems.
